The social dimension of online gaming has also played a crucial role in its popularity. Unlike traditional single-player experiences, many online games emphasize interaction with others. Players can collaborate in teams, compete against rivals, or simply chat while exploring virtual landscapes. These interactions often lead to the formation of communities that extend beyond the game itself, fostering friendships and shared experiences. For many, online games serve as a meeting place where distance and geography become irrelevant, replaced by shared goals and mutual interests.
Technological advancements have further enhanced the appeal of online games. Improved graphics, faster internet speeds, and sophisticated game design have made virtual worlds more realistic and engaging than ever before. Developers continuously experiment with new mechanics, storytelling techniques, and interactive elements, pushing the boundaries of what games can offer. The rise of cloud gaming and cross-platform play has also made it easier for players to access their favorite titles from anywhere, ensuring a seamless experience across devices.

The economic impact of online gaming is equally noteworthy. The industry has grown into a multi-billion-dollar market, with revenue generated through game sales, subscriptions, and in-game purchases. This growth has created numerous opportunities for developers, designers, streamers, and content creators. Streaming platforms and video-sharing sites have given rise to a new form of entertainment where players share their gameplay with audiences, turning gaming into both a profession and a form of storytelling.
Despite its many advantages, online gaming also presents challenges. Concerns about screen time, online behavior, and data privacy have prompted discussions about responsible gaming practices. Developers and platforms are increasingly implementing measures to promote positive interactions and ensure player safety. Features such as parental controls, reporting systems, and time management tools aim to create a healthier gaming environment for all users.
